Ai đó có thể giải thích cách từ khóa type và toán tử # hoạt động trong scala và cách sử dụng? Hãy xem các ví dụ. //Example1
scala> type t1 = Option.type
defined type alias t1
//Shouldn't this work
Tôi muốn chuyển một đối tượng đến một hàm chấp nhận một đối số với một kiểu được chiếu, và nhận Scala để suy luận rằng kiểu của đối tượng đến từ đối tượng bao quanh nó. Dưới đây là một số mã đơn giản
Tôi có một số khó khăn khi Scala suy ra đúng loại từ một phép chiếu kiểu. xem xét như sau: trait Foo {
type X
}
trait Bar extends Foo {
type X = String
}
def baz[F <: Foo](x: F#X): Uni